
Speaking after the meeting, Mrs Badjo said that she had discussed the activities of her institution with the PDSRSG. « We discussed the kind of activities that the Commission carries out which gave him a better idea of the sort of work we do, » said the president of the Commission.
The two personalities also discussed the latest developments in the socio-political situation, including the forthcoming presidential election and the need to respect human rights that are linked to it. Mrs Badjo also announced that her institution was going to set up an observatory to monitor the human rights situation during the electoral period.
«The elections will be a major activity for our Commission. We intend to set up a platform which we launched last week to monitor human rights during the electoral period and raise the alarm in case of any violation,» she said.
